Judge orders rider in child porn case

Keith Kinnaird News Editor | Hagadone News Network | UPDATED 9 years, 10 months AGO
by Keith Kinnaird News Editor
| February 12, 2016 6:00 AM

SANDPOINT — Jurisdiction was retained Wednesday for a Kootenai man who pleaded guilty to possessing child pornography, 1st District Court records show.

That means Lance Robert Pearson will spend up to a year in prison before a decision is made to release him onto probation or imprison him for up to seven years.

Pearson, 29, apologized for his conduct, asked for the court’s mercy and noted that he cooperated with law enforcement, according to court records.
